1. Personalized Learning: Adapting to Every Student’s Needs
Personalized learning through technology has been a major advantage in modern education. Adaptive learning software, such as Khan Academy and DreamBox, allow teachers to cater to individual learning styles, challenging advanced students and giving others the support they need to succeed. This approach has had proven benefits: a Gates Foundation study found that students who received personalized instruction achieved 130% of expected gains during the school year.
With technology, students receive immediate feedback, helping them identify areas for improvement. For example, tools like IXL and Edmodo allow students to complete exercises at their own pace, allowing them to understand complex concepts before moving on. This approach has shown improved results in subjects such as math, with students who participate in individualized programs consistently scoring higher on standardized tests.

6. Real-Time Assessment and Instant Feedback
In a traditional classroom, feedback on assignments can take days, sometimes weeks, to get back to students. Technology accelerates this process, enabling real-time analysis and immediate feedback. Tools like Socrative and Edpuzzle provide quizzes and tasks that teachers can immediately grade, helping students identify areas for immediate improvement.
Research shows that students who receive timely feedback perform significantly better than students who don’t. For example, research from the American Educational Research Association showed that students who received immediate feedback scored 24% higher on subsequent tests. Real-time analytics allow teachers to accurately track student progress, allowing them to adjust their instructional strategies accordingly.
7. Supporting Special Needs and Inclusive Learning
Technology has been a game changer in making education more inclusive for students with special needs. According to the National Center for Education Statistics, about 7.3 million students in the United States receive special education. Assistive technologies, such as speech and text processing software, screen readers, and special keyboards, enable these students to fully engage in learning
For example, tools like Google’s Read&Write help students with dyslexia by converting text to audio, making it easier for them to process information. Similarly, visual aids such as screen enhancement software help visually impaired students read digital text. By providing these helpful tools, technology creates an inclusive learning environment where all students, regardless of their abilities, have the opportunity to succeed.
8. Fostering Collaboration and Communication
Communication is an essential skill in today’s workforce, and technology has made it easier for students to collaborate on projects and activities. Tools like Google Workspace, Microsoft Teams, and Slack allow students to collaborate in real time, share ideas, exchange documents, and communicate seamlessly. A study by the University of Southern California found that students who use collaborative tools show a 20% improvement in teamwork and problem solving skills.
Learning management systems (LMS) such as Canvas, Blackboard, and Moodle help teachers organize learning materials and improve communication with students. Teachers can use these forums to post activities, share feedback, and communicate directly with students and parents. This intuitive interaction allows students to ask questions and seek clarification, creating a more interactive and supportive learning environment.
